Falcon.io

Falcon.io offers a unified SaaS platform for social media listening, engaging, publishing, measuring and management. We help our enterprise clients to explore the full potential of social media marketing and instill a social-first thought process in their employees. In January 2019 we joined the Cision family, and together we help brands build better relationships with their customers. Falcon.io has achieved great international traction in the market, with its technology endorsed by partnerships with Facebook, Twitter, Linkedin and Instagram. Our diverse and global client portfolio includes Carlsberg, Tiger, IWC Watches, Coca-Cola and many more. We launched in Copenhagen in 2010 under our CEO Ulrik Bo Larsen. Today we also have offices in New York, Berlin, Budapest, Sofia and Melbourne. NordicWatts ApS.

WHO ARE WE? Do you like energy savings? Because we do! NordicWatts has developed a solution to easily measure energy consumption (400V/3-phase) from large equipment such as air compressors, ovens, heaters air conditioning, etc., and reveal major cost savings. Our handheld, plug & play device provide firms and energy consultants with precise, reliable and convenient data measurements – helping create an energy efficient environment. WHY MEASURE ENERGY? “If you can’t measure it, you can’t improve it” Lord Kelvin Firms experience several benefits when assessing their energy consumption, including cost savings and the promotion of environmental action. In addition, governments are increasingly mandating that companies operating large equipment must perform energy-efficiency assessments.

Airtame

Airtame produces an HDMI hardware product of the same name. This wireless presentation solution has been chosen by more than 18,000 businesses and educational institutions all over the world. The Airtame 2 allows presenters to share their screen wirelessly, from a computer or mobile device to a TV, projector or monitor. Tattoodo

Tattoodo launched in 2013, and have raised more than $15m USD from some of the most prominent Venture firms in the world, to become the largest community for the Global tattoo industry. We are the #1 global destination for tattoo collectors, artists, and shops, offering original and curated content, a dedicated community, and the exclusive feature of being able to book tattoo appointments around the world. We are creating a two-sided marketplace and introducing the first digital booking platform for the tattoo industry. An indicator that Tattoodo is onto something comes from the important people backing us, involving both Christian Stadil, Daniel Agger, Jimmy Maymann and Tom Ryan from Threadless. The platform has staff writers all around the world and is also striving for an international atmosphere, with a New York office.
